Write JavaScript programs to solve the following problems. Store your answer in
separate html files.
1. The aircraft has 184 seats and they are categorised into four types.
Write a JavaScript program which iterates the integers from 1 to 184. For multiples
of 5 print "type A" instead of the number and for the multiples of 7 print "type B".
For numbers which are multiples of both 5 and 7 print "type C".
